CVGs [Coriolis vibrating gyroscope] have three features in common : a mechanical resonator, an oscillator and a force-displacement sensor. One mode of the resonator is maintained in resonance by an oscillator loop while oscillations are induced in a second vibration mode. The amplitude of the oscillations gives a signal proportional to the input angular rate. A wide variety of resonators, actuation and sensing schemes are possible. The simplest resonator is a tuning fork.

... the following characteristics can be those of a rate gyro designed to measure a rate of turn up to 100 DEG per second. The mechanical resonator comprises four beams each having a cross-section of 6 mm by 6 mm, and each 30-35 mm long. The piezo-electric elements are constituted by pellets of PZT having a thickness of a few tenths of a millimeter, metal-coated on both faces, and bonded to the beams.

A device which makes use of a planet’s magnetic field to stabilise a satellite.

CONT

The angular momentum of a tumbling orbiting satellite is changed to reduce the spinning of the spacecraft such that the spacecraft can operate in an essentially stabilized condition. The change in spin rate is accomplished by the development of a magnetic torque by commutation of magnetic air coils in response to Earth sensor signals controlled by spacecraft logic. The coils are disposed to produce magnetic dipoles transverse to the satellite spin axis such that by interacting with the Earth's magnetic field a torque is developed in a direction opposite the spin vector. The logic selects the proper magnetic dipole based upon data from sensors detecting the presence of the Earth for the development of the desired magnetic torque.

Stabilisation. This stage will start automatically upon detection of the spacecraft separation from the launch vehicle. Spacecraft initialisation consists of switching on sensors : GPS, Magnetometer, Gyro and Sun Sensor. At launcher release, the spacecraft will autonomously recognise its angular rate, damp it and acquire controlled attitude. Upon success of de-spin and first sun acquisition, RADARSAT-2 will start to acquire a coarse stable 3-axes attitude. This process should take 2-3 orbits.

Rate gyroscopes provide a means for measuring angular rate about a particular axis and are traditionally used in a variety of high accuracy control and guidance systems in aircraft, missiles and ships. The conventional rate gyro, based on a high speed rotor, is a mature but relatively complex, delicate and expensive product. For these reasons and the increasing market for less expensive devices, a great deal of research effort has been invested into the development of a rate gyro with a vibrating sensitive element, which would eliminate the need for ball bearing suspensions and hence reduce the mechanical complexity and cost whilst greatly increasing life and robustness. The principle of operation of these devices is based on the coriolis force, which couples together two degenerate modes of vibration of the sensitive element when the sensor rotates.
